Rain is likely overnight; temperatures will hover just above freezing, that combined with a still very warm ground / soil temperature will limit any wintry impacts. Snow could mix with the rain, but accumulation is unlikely, roads will be wet, there is minor concern for slick bridges and over passes, Tuesday morning. The rest of Tuesday is cool and damp with temperatures near 40 degrees.
The rest of the week is mostly uneventful, temperatures won't be extremely cold and the chance of rain is waning. This weekend looks fair, with highs near 50 and sunshine. Next week, the focus turns to Thanksgiving. Precipitation is possible, depending on timing it could be a wintry mix if temperatures are cold enough. There are too many IFs at this point, best to say we'll be watching it, but a major impact is not expected at this point.
Tonight: Rain after midnight; snow may mix by early morning. Low 35.
Tuesday: Lingering showers, chilly. High 42.
Wednesday: Mostly cloudy. High 46.
Thursday: Mostly cloudy. High 55.
